Racking Handle Access PrevenƟon Padlocking
A standard feature allowing the user to store the racking handle
and to padlock the storage locaƟon, thus prevenƟng the
handles unauthorized use.
The padlocking device accepts up to three padlocks with a hasp
dimension of 3 to 8 mm (Fig. 3.4 C). The device can only be used
when the breaker' s mobile porƟon is in TEST or DISCONNECTED
posiƟon and/or fully removed from the casseƩe.
To engage the device and place padlocks :
1. Ensure that the breaker's mobile porƟon is in TEST or
DISCONNECTED posiƟon and/or is fully removed from the
casseƩe. (see posiƟon indicator Fig. 3.2 A)
2. Remove and store the Racking Handle. (In it's storage
locaƟon)
3. Extend the locking lever (Fig. 3.4 C) to allow access to the
padlocking holes.
To disengage the locking feature, simply remove the padlocks
and push the lever back into a posiƟon that is Ňush with the
casseƩe front facia.
Now the Racking handle can be removed from it's storage
locaƟon.
